Applies to: desktop apps only
The AlertEnabled property gets or sets a Boolean value that indicates whether an alert will be issued when the round-trip threshold set in the Threshold property is exceeded.
This property is read/write.
Syntax
HRESULT put_AlertEnabled(
VARIANT_BOOL fAlertEnabled
);
HRESULT get_AlertEnabled(
VARIANT_BOOL *pfAlertEnabled
);
' Data type: Boolean
Property AlertEnabled( _
ByVal fAlertEnabled As VARIANT_BOOL, _
ByVal pfAlertEnabled As VARIANT_BOOL _
) As Boolean
Property value
Boolean value that indicates whether an alert is enabled for the connectivity verifier.
Error codes
These property methods return S_OK if the call is successful; otherwise, they return an error code.
Remarks
This property is read/write. Its default value is True (VARIANT_TRUE in C++).
